Who needs certified fire investigator?
01
Certified fire investigators are needed by various individuals and organizations, including:
02
- Fire departments and fire investigation units
03
- Insurance companies
04
- Law enforcement agencies
05
- Legal firms
06
- Government agencies
07
- Private businesses and industries
08
These entities require certified fire investigators to accurately determine the cause and origin of fires, conduct investigations, gather evidence, and provide expert testimony in legal proceedings. Certified fire investigators play a crucial role in ensuring fire safety, preventing arson, and determining liability in fire-related incidents.

What is certified fire investigator?
A certified fire investigator is a professional who has been trained and certified to examine the causes and origins of fires, ensuring proper investigation procedures are followed to determine whether a fire was accidental or intentional.

What is the purpose of certified fire investigator?
The purpose of the certified fire investigator program is to ensure that individuals investigating fires possess the necessary skills and knowledge to accurately discern the cause of a fire, thereby promoting safety and justice.
What information must be reported on certified fire investigator?
The report must include details such as the investigator's qualifications, the methodologies used in the investigation, findings regarding the fire's cause, and any relevant supporting evidence.
